COUNTY COURTS.
A Court is held every day for criminal and summary business. Or-
dinary Court, Tuesday, Wednesday, Thursday, and Friday. Small
Debt Court, Monday, Wednesday and Thursday. Court under
Debts Recovery (Scotland) Act, Monday. Appeal Courts, Monday,
Tuesday, and Friday for Lower Ward cases; Wednesday for Upper
and Middle Ward cases.

JUSTICE OF PEACE COURT,
County Buildings, 117 Brunswick Street.
Sits every Monday and Thursday at 11 o'clock within the Justices
Hall, County buildings, for cases of crime, and cases under the
Revenue, Roads, Weights and Measures, &c. Laws, and every
Tuesday and Friday at 11 o'clock for the disposal of small debt
cases.

SMALL DEBT COURT OF THE JUSTICES.
This Court, on six days' inducias, decides claims of £5 and under
sits every Tuesday and Friday at 11 o'clock forenoon, in the Smal
Debt Court, Justices' Hall, County buildings, 117 Brunswick
street. Two Justices are the Judges. Summonses and warrants
are issued for the Lower Ward of Lanarkshire at the Justice of the
Peace Clerks' Office, County buildings, entering by 117 Brunswick
street.
